3ware Disk Array Configuration Utility Figure 7. Disk Array Configuration Main Display, RAID 1 Example Throughout the utility (see Figure 7) use the Up and Down arrow keys to navigate, Enter to select the disks or buttons and F1 for context sensitive help. Toggle Hot Spare verbiage is black when the cursor is over a drive that can be specified as a hot spare and gray when hot spare cannot be specified. If you've made mistakes and want to start over, pressing F6 will return your starting values. Pressing Escape will exit the configuration utility as well as abandon your changes. Pressing F8 will save your changes and exit the utility. Displaying advance details Selecting Shift-F5 will show the software versions (BIOS, Firmware, monitor) and slot # of the 3ware card (see Figure 8). Press Escape to return to the main 3ware Disk Array Configuration screen. www.3ware.com 27
